Available in PDF, EPUB and Kindle. Book excerpt: We have measured the parity-violating electroweak asymmetry in the elastic scattering of polarized electrons from protons. Significant contributions to this asymmetry could arise from the contributions of strange form factors in the nucleon. The measured asymmetry is A = -15.05 ± 0.98(stat) ± 0.56(syst) ppm at the kinematic point [theta]{sub lab} = 12.3{sup o} and Q2 = 0.477 (GeV/c)2. Based on these data as well as data on electromagnetic form factors, we extract the linear combination of strange form factors G{sub E}{sup s} + 0.392G{sub M}{sup s} = 0.014 ± 0.020 ± 0.010 where the first error arises from this experiment and the second arises from the electromagnetic form factor data. This paper provides a full description of the special experimental techniques employed for precisely measuring the small asymmetry, including the first use of a strained GaAs crystal and a laser-Compton polarimeter in a fixed target parity-violation experiment.

Available in PDF, EPUB and Kindle. Book excerpt: We have measured the parity-violating electroweak asymmetry in the elastic scattering of polarized electrons from the proton at Jefferson Laboratory. The kinematic point ([theta]_lab = 12.3 deg. and (Q^2) = 0.48 (GeV/c)^2) is chosen to provide sensitivity to the strange electric form factor G^s_E. A 3.36 GeV beam of longitudinally polarized electrons was scattered from protons in a liquid hydrogen target. The scattered flux was detected by a pair of spectrometers which focussed the elastically-scattered electrons onto total-absorption detectors. The detector signals were integrated and digitized by a custom data acquisition system. A feedback system reduced systematic errors by controlling helicity-correlated beam intensity differences at the sub-ppm (part per million) level. The experimental result, A = 14.5 +/- 2.0 (stat) +/- 1.1 (syst) ppm, is consistent with the electroweak Standard Model with no additional contributions from strange quarks. In particular, the measurement implies G^S_E + 0.39 G^s_M = 0.023 +/- 0.040 +/- 0.026 ([delta]G^n_E), where the last uncertainty is due to the estimated uncertainty in the neutron electric form factor G^n_E . This result represents the first experimental constraint of the strange electric form factor.

Book excerpt: We have measured the parity-violating electroweak asymmetry in the elastic scattering of polarized electrons from 4He at an average scattering angle [theta]{sub lab} = 5.7 degrees and a four-momentum transfer Q2 = 0.091 GeV2. From these data, for the first time, the strange electric form factor of the nucleon G{sub E}{sup s} can be isolated. The measured asymmetry of A{sub PV} = 6.72 ± 0.84 (stat) ± 0.21 (syst) parts per million yields a value of G{sub E}{sup s} = -0.038 ± 0.042 (stat) ± 0.010 (syst), consistent with zero.

Available in PDF, EPUB and Kindle. Book excerpt: The parity-violating asymmetries between a longitudinally-polarized electron beam and an unpolarized deuterium target have been measured recently. The measurement covered two kinematic points in the deep inelastic scattering region and five in the nucleon resonance region. We provide here details of the experimental setup, data analysis, and results on all asymmetry measurements including parity-violating electron asymmetries and those of inclusive pion production and beam-normal asymmetries. The parity-violating deep-inelastic asymmetries were used to extract the electron-quark weak effective couplings, and the resonance asymmetries provided the first evidence for quark-hadron duality in electroweak observables. These electron asymmetries and their interpretation were published earlier, but are presented here in more detail.

Book excerpt: We report on a new measurement of the parity-violating asymmetry in quasielastic electron scattering from the deuteron at backward angles at Q2 = 0.038 (GeV/c)2. This quantity provides a determination of the neutral weak axial vector form factor of the nucleon, which can potentially receive large electroweak corrections. The measured asymmetry A = z3.51±0.57 (stat)±0.58 (syst) ppm is consistent with theoretical predictions. We also report on updated results of the previous experiment at Q2 = 0.091 (GeV/c)2, which are also consistent with theoretical predictions.

Book excerpt: The goal of Experiment E04-115 (the G0 backward angle measurement) at Jefferson Lab is to investigate the contributions of strange quarks to the fundamental properties of the nucleon. The experiment measures parity-violating asymmetries in elastic electron scattering off hydrogen and quasielastic electron scattering off deuterium at backward angles at Q2 = 0.631 (GeV/c)2 and Q2 = 0.232 (GeV/c)2. The backward angle measurement represents the second phase of the G0 experiment. The first phase, Experiment E00-006 (the G0 forward angle experiment), measured parity-violating asymmetries in elastic electron scattering off hydrogen at forward angles over a Q2 range of 0.1-1.0 (GeV/c)2. The experiments used a polarized electron beam and unpolarized hydrogen and deuterium liquid targets. From these measurements, along with the electromagnetic form factors, one can extract the contribution of the strange quark to the proton's charge and magnetization distributions. Book excerpt: Experiments on parity violation in electron scattering measure the asymmetry A = [sigma][sub R] - [sigma][sub L]/[sigma][sub R] + [sigma][sub L] where [sigma][sub R(L)] is the cross section for Right(Left) handed longitudinally polarized electrons. This asymmetry arises, in first order, from the interference between photon and Z-boson exchange amplitudes. Experiments make two basic uses of the Z-boson as a probe in electron-quark or electron-nucleon scattering. Historically the first usage was to test the electroweak theory in regions of kinematics where the hadronic structure is sufficiently understood. They discuss the application of higher energies at Jefferson Lab to repeat the SLAC e-D deep inelastic parity violation experiment [1] at a level of precision [approx] 0.5% in sin[sup 2][theta][sub W] which would be a useful constrain on extensions of the Standard Model [2]. The second, more recent usage of the Z-boson probe is to assume the Standard Model is correct at about the 1% level and use this as a unique method to address fundamental issues of nucleon structure, such as: (1) are the strange quarks an important component of the nucleon [3]; (2) In deep inelastic scattering, are the high momentum quarks u or d quarks? To address the first question, they discuss the feasibility of extending the HAPPEX experiment to higher Q[sup 2]. For the second question, they discuss a possible measurement of the ratio of valence quarks d/u in the proton using deep inelastic parity violation.

Book excerpt: We report on parity-violating asymmetries in the nucleon resonance region measured using 5 - 6 GeV longitudinally polarized electrons scattering off an unpolarized deuterium target. These results are the first parity-violating asymmetry data in the resonance region beyond the [Delta](1232), and provide a verification of quark-hadron duality in the nucleon electroweak [gamma] Z interference structure functions at the (10-15)% level. The results are of particular interest to models relevant for calculating the [gamma] Z box-diagram corrections to elastic parity-violating electron scattering measurements.

Book excerpt: Fundamental interactions between electrons and protons, coupling between photons and Z bosons, and the underlying substructure of the proton, can all be probed through scattering experiments designed to measure the parity-violating asymmetry due to a mixing of electromagnetic and weak forces. Our research involves testing the limits of the standard model in search of new physics, by comparing high precision theoretical predictions of this asymmetry, along with the proton's weak charge and the weak mixing angle, to recent experimental measurements. We were ultimately able to achieve results consistent with experimental observations, by accounting for radiative corrections beyond single boson exchange. Our calculations include up to first-order Feynman diagrams containing 1 loop integrals, soft-photon bremsstrahlung, and we account for additional box diagram corrections. We also consider the addition of a new weakly-interacting dark Z boson (Z') to the Standard Model, and investigate how it affects the calculated asymmetry.
